黑狐家游戏

Windows 7 上 ASP.NET Web 服务器的设置与优化指南,win7iis配置网站服务器配置

欧气 1 0

本文目录导读:

  1. 安装 IIS
  2. 配置 ASP.NET 支持
  3. 部署和调试 ASP.NET 应用程序
  4. 优化 ASP.NET 性能

在Windows 7上搭建和配置ASP.NET Web服务器是开发人员经常需要执行的任务之一,本指南将详细介绍如何在Windows 7平台上安装、配置和优化IIS(Internet Information Services),以支持ASP.NET应用程序。

安装 IIS

  1. 打开“控制面板”:点击开始菜单中的“控制面板”,然后选择“程序和功能”。

  2. 添加或删除程序:在“控制面板”中找到并双击“程序和功能”,然后在左侧导航栏中选择“打开或关闭 Windows 功能”。

  3. 勾选所需组件

    Windows 7 上 ASP.NET Web 服务器的设置与优化指南,win7iis配置网站服务器配置

    图片来源于网络,如有侵权联系删除

    • 在弹出的窗口中,找到并勾选“IIS(Internet 信息服务)”下的所有选项,包括“管理工具”、“应用程序池”、“性能计数器集”等。
    • 点击“确定”按钮进行安装。
  4. 完成安装:等待系统自动下载并安装所需的文件,完成后会提示您重新启动计算机。

  5. 验证安装成功:重启后再次进入“控制面板”>“程序和功能”,确认已安装好所有必要的组件。

配置 ASP.NET 支持

  1. 打开 IIS 管理器:在开始菜单中搜索“inetmgr”,打开IIS管理器。

  2. 创建网站

    • 右键点击“本地服务器”节点,选择“新建”>“网站”。
    • 输入网站的名称、物理路径等信息,并指定端口(默认为80)。
    • 点击“绑定”按钮设置IP地址和协议类型(如HTTP)。
  3. 启用 ASP.NET 应用程序池

    • 在左侧导航栏中选择“应用程序池”,右键点击默认的应用程序池(通常是“DefaultAppPool”)。
    • 选择“属性”,在“回收”标签页下调整应用程序池的回收策略和时间间隔。
  4. 配置安全性和性能

    • 在网站属性对话框中,可以设置访问权限、错误日志、日志记录等相关参数。
    • 在高级选项卡中,可以根据需要进行额外的配置,例如启用压缩、缓存等。

部署和调试 ASP.NET 应用程序

  1. 编译项目:确保您的Visual Studio项目中包含正确的引用和配置文件(如Web.config),然后编译生成发布包。

  2. 部署到服务器:使用FTP或其他方式将生成的发布包上传至服务器上的网站目录。

    Windows 7 上 ASP.NET Web 服务器的设置与优化指南,win7iis配置网站服务器配置

    图片来源于网络,如有侵权联系删除

  3. 测试运行:通过浏览器访问 http://localhost/ 或相应的域名来测试应用程序是否正常运行。

  4. 故障排除:如果遇到问题,可以通过查看IIS日志、事件查看器以及调试工具等方法查找原因并进行修复。

优化 ASP.NET 性能

  1. 启用 HTTP 压缩:在IIS管理器中,选中要启用的网站,然后在右侧窗格中找到“性能”选项卡,勾选“启用静态内容压缩”复选框即可。

  2. 配置缓存策略:合理利用ASP.NET内置的输出缓存机制可以提高页面加载速度,同时减少数据库查询次数。

  3. 优化代码结构:避免不必要的数据库连接操作,尽量使用存储过程代替直接SQL语句;对频繁使用的业务逻辑进行封装成方法或类以提高可重用性。

  4. 监控和分析性能瓶颈:利用第三方工具如New Relic、AppDynamics等进行实时监测和分析,及时发现潜在的性能问题并进行改进。

通过以上步骤,您可以成功地在一台Windows 7机器上搭建并配置了一个基本的ASP.NET Web服务器环境,这只是基础部分,在实际应用过程中还需要不断地学习和探索,以适应不断变化的互联网需求和新技术的发展趋势,希望本文能为广大开发者提供一个良好的起点,助力他们在未来的职业生涯中取得更大的成就!

标签: #win7 aspx服务器配置

黑狐家游戏
  • 评论列表

留言评论